建立综合高效的人力资源管理系统.doc
《建立综合高效的人力资源管理系统.doc》由会员分享,可在线阅读,更多相关《建立综合高效的人力资源管理系统.doc(17页珍藏版)》请在冰豆网上搜索。
编号:
建立综合高效的人力资源管理系统
管理创新课题成果报告
课题类型:
创新型
课题组负责人:
研制单位:
成果完成时间:
2011年12月10日
内容提要
职工信息管理和工资核算是人力资源管理的重要部分,面对大量的人力资源信息,采用人工处理既浪费时间、又浪费人力和物力,并且数据的准确性低。
因此建立一个综合高效、简单实用、内部互联、资源共享的人力资源软件进行职工信息维护、工资核算等自动化处理变得十分重要。
本课题是以客户端/服务器模式高效地实现了人力资源管理系统的各项功能,可进行完备的用户管理、机构管理、人员管理、工资管理、考勤管理、信息查询等功能,整个系统具有简单实用、方便快捷、高安全性、高可靠性等优点,节省了购买、维修软件的成本,实现自主开发维护,提高了企业的效率和竞争力。
目录
一、课题选择…………………………………..………1
1.现状分析……………………………………………1
2.选题理由…………………………………………..1
3.课题的目的和意义………………………………..1
4.预期达到的目标…………………………………..2
二、课题研究与实施…………………………………..2
1.科学原理和方法………………………………….2
2.系统设计………………………………………….3
3.数据库设计……………………………………….8
4.运行界面的设计与实现………………………….9
5.应用实施……………………….……………….13
三、取得的效果………………………………..…...14
1.社会效益………………………………..….….14
2.经济效益…………………………………….….15
3.整体绩效……………………………….…….…16
四、跟踪反馈………………………………………...17
一、课题选择
1.现状分析
面对不断蓬勃壮大发展的业务,单位在管理上必须跃上一个新台阶,实现综合高效科学管理,建立综合高效的人力资源管理系统已成为当务之急。
人力资源科便凭借科内精通计算机编程人员建立了小型数据库下的局部计算机管理系统,该系统在开展业务合作、实现局部数据共享、人事、工资管理等方面为企业带来了可观的绩效,为实现企业的规范化管理打下了坚实的基础,积累了信息化管理的理论和实践经验。
但该软件系统功能单一、技术相对落后、构建的相对固定性和企业的发展壮大、组织机构的调整变化、业务开展的延伸之间的矛盾日趋激烈,系统越来越不能适应公司目前和未来的各种管理需求。
2.选题理由
人力资源部门在人员少的情况下承担了大量的工作任务,需要建立一套适合生产需要的人力资源管理系统,以提高工作效率和质量。
3.课题的目的和意义
建立综合高效的人力资源管理系统对提高人力资源管理水平,实现人力资源管理现代化具有重要意义,是实现以人为中心的管理,促进企业现代化的必然选择。
借助先进的计算机技术、网络通信技术以及基于先进管理模式的计算机管理系统软件,在根本上把管理从粗放型转向程序化,借助自动化系统,实现了专业化、信息化的管理模式,实现集中管理,使业务周期缩短,成本降低,提高竞争力。
随着管理要求的提高,人力资源管理系统需要具备人事业务流程的制订、修改、控制等操作,这正是本系统开发的目的和意义。
4.预期达到的目标
人力资源管理系统以经营管理为目标,以信息管理为基础,采用成熟、先进的计算机软、硬件集成技术,融入科学的人事管理思想和模式,对企业及其下属单位的人员信息进行采集、储存、处理和分析,使其及时准确地反映企业的人员现状、人员变动情况、薪资情况等人事信息,为各层管理者提供快速准确的人事管理依据与辅助决策数据。
通过人力资源管理系统使得管理者快速高效地完成企业日常事务中的人事工作,降低了人力资源管理成本,使管理者能集中精力在企业战略目标;另一方面,通过软件及时收集与整理分析大量的人力资源管理数据,为企业战略决策的生成与实施控制提供强有力的支持,以提高组织目标实现的可能性。
二、课题研究与实施
1.科学原理和方法
本系统是采用灵活高效的编程语言delphi5.5,和后台使用支持数据共享、网络互联的sqlserver2000数据库技术以及先进的管理理念开发的智能人力资源管理系统。
他提供了完备的用户管理、机构管理、人员管理、工资管理、考勤管理、信息查询等功能,整个系统具有简单实用、方便快捷、高安全性、高可靠性等优点。
2.系统设计
根据本系统的需求,结合实际管理情况,本系统应用有如下功能模块,分别是用户管理、机构管理、人员管理、工资管理、考勤管理、信息查询及系统设置。
用户管理:
分为高级用户和普通用户,主要用于对公司员工的修改和查看。
机构管理:
用于部门的创建、删除及部门信息的修改和查询等。
人员管理:
用于人员基本信息的管理,如新增、修改、删除等。
工资管理:
用于对员工的基本工资、津补贴维护,月度工资核算,工资单打印等操作。
考勤管理:
用于对员工的考勤信息的导入、计算、查询等操作。
信息查询:
用于对员工的相关信息、各部门及全体职工基本信息、工资信息、考勤信息等查询操作。
系统设置:
用于对系统的一些基本参数的设置。
系统总体设计功能模块图如下图:
人力资源管理系统
用户管理
工资管理
系统设置
机构管理
信息查询
考勤管理
人员管理
用户管理:
为了对用户进行权限划分,本系统设置了两种类型的用户,即高级用户和普通用户。
一方面管理员不仅可以进行查看,而且可以进行增、删、改等合理的操作,另一方面普通用户只能查看相关信息,以便及时了解有关个人工资的具体核算,及早发现问题和解决问题,这样可确保公司管理体制的透明化、公开化,让员工真正参与到公司的运营决策中来。
用户管理流程图如下:
高级管理员登陆系统
增加人员
退出用户管理系统
资料修改
删除人员
员工查询
人员调动
机构管理:
单位各机构并不是一成不变的,根据单位生产需要,机构和人员有可能进行调整和变动,针对这种情况,利用计算机可以减少繁杂的操作。
管理员对机构管理的流程图如下:
高级管理员登录系统
增加部门
删除部门
修改部门
查询部门
退出部门管理
人员管理
对于新进单位的员工,管理者可以将其添加至对应的部门,并对个人信息进行注册登记、备案等。
对于辞职、调出等原因需减册的职工,管理者可以将其从所在部门名单中减册,将其放入减册人员里面。
对于因调动或登记错误及需要更新的信息,管理者可以随时更改,避免发生不必要的损失。
管理员对员工信息管理的流程如图所示:
高级管理员登录系统
增加人员
资料修改
员工查询
人员调动
退出人员管理
删除人员
工资管理
对于员工的工资发放,系统会进行全面、合理、准确的计算,在计算的同时会扣除因请假、迟到、旷工等的工资,并扣除个人所得税及相关交纳的“三险一金”等费用。
同时,该系统也将负责计算各类人员的津补贴、月度奖、安全抵押等,确定应发工资和实发工资的项目,最后分析、生成汇总表和工资单。
管理员对工资管理的流程图如下图:
高级管理员登录系统
工资录入
工资修改
工资查询
退出工资管理
考勤管理
对于职工从考勤系统导出的考勤,本系统会进行准确的逻辑数据校验,对校验出来有问题的项目会筛选明细,供管理员分析修改。
本系统计算考勤是采用倒减法,即用当月日历天数扣除公休、请假、迟到、旷工等,最终计算出来每个职工当月出勤天数。
在考勤计算完成后,才能进行工资计算。
管理员对考勤管理的流程图如下图:
高级管理员登录系统
考勤数据录入
逻辑数据校验
数据修改
退出考勤管理
信息查询
其他模块功能只对管理员开放,而信息查询功能可以为普通职工开放。
普通职工只有查询权限,没有修改权限,只有管理员才有修改权限。
信息查询可以对庞大的数据资源进行准确、有效、快速的统计、分析,这可以为领导、操作员和普通职工掌握数据提供方便。
信息查询包括基本信息、工资、考勤等信息查询。
信息查询模块如下图所示:
高级管理员登录系统
查询个人信息息
查询公共信息
退出信息查询
系统设置
对系统基本参数的设置,不仅有利于减少复杂的手工输入操作,更主要的是可以使系统动态地添加、删除一些基本信息,如工龄的设置、年功工资的核算、岗位工资和住房补贴标准的确定等。
3.数据库设计
E-R图如下图所示:
管理员
设置
补贴
编号
住房补贴
下井津贴
职称津贴
录入
基本信息
编号
姓名
性别
出生日期
籍贯
学历
......
录入
设置
工资
毕业信息
录入
职称
编号
职称资格
聘任时间
编号
毕业院校
设置
职务
编号
所属部门
职务级别
编号
姓名
基本工资
年功工资
…..
…….
通过对系统的分析,结合系统要点,使用SQLServer2000数据库技术生成数据库物理模型,其主要数据表设计如下。
(1)用户信息表,主要存放管理员和普通用户权限的各类用户的用户名和密码等。
(2)职工基本信息表,主要存放所有职工的个人基本信息,如年龄、参加工作时间,籍贯等。
(3)职工基本工资信息表,主要存放所有职工的工资标准,如岗位工资标准、年功工资标准及各类保险标准等。
(4)职工基本津补贴信息表,主要存放所有职工的津补贴标准,如住房补贴标准、下井费标准、职称津贴标准等。
(5)月度工资表,主要存放当月职工核算完的工资数据,如计时工资、计件工资、应发工资、实发工资等。
(6)月度考勤表,主要存放当月职工核算完的考勤数据,如出勤工数、请假天数、旷工天数等。
(7)历史工资表,主要存放职工之前各月份的工资数据,格式和月度工资表一样,为查询数据所用。
(8)历史考勤表,主要存放职工之前各月份的考勤数据,格式和月度考勤表一样,为查询数据所用。
4.运行界面的设计与实现
当程序运行后,会打开在本系统的登陆界面,如下图:
系统登陆是人力资源管理中最先使用的功能,因为用户登陆在数据库中使用的是用户信息表,用户表中由一个字段,是用来标示是否是管理员的。
在登陆时要根据数据库的这个字段来判断此用户是否具有管理员权限。
当用户输入正确的用户名和密码,才能成功点击劳动工资图标,进入主界面,如下图:
主界面包含了机构信息、职工基本信息、工资信息、津补贴信息等,还具备数据导出功能。
只有管理员才能在主界面修改信息,如增加、删除、修改、查询等操作。
可以有选择性的导出,其中基本信息导出运行界面如下图:
工资核算界面,可以自动核算和手工修改相结合,方便了工资核算流程。
其中工资修改运行界面如下:
还可以以浏览式方式进行工资修改,如下图:
考勤管理可以进行校验和计算,考勤计算运行界面如下图:
报表打印功能,可以批量打印工资单、分析单,数据表等,其中工资单打印界面如下图:
信息查询,可以进行基本信息查询、考勤信息查询、工资信息查询等,其中工资查询运行界面如下图:
三、取得的效果
1.社会效益
人力资源管理系统建成后,将实现人力资源管理人员、部门主管和普通员工在同一个系统平台上工作和沟通,实现数据的集中统一和管理分布式应用,全面